Designer: Keisai Eisen Era: Mid Showa | Currency: $ / £ / € Price: ![]() Description: This print is from the series Kuruwa Hakkei (Eight Views of the Pleasure Quarters), which depicts the life of courtesans in Shin-Yoshiwara, Tokyo's red-light district. Eisen is noted for his depictions of the ladies of the quarter, and here he conveys a courtesan lost in thought leaning against the lattice of a bay window. This particular print is a post-war reproduction by Yamada Shoin. ![]() Browse thumbnail pages of various selections from the catalogue ...
